Chevrolet is all set to debut the next-generation Malibu in New York and are also planning on giving the public a look at the

hybrid option of the Malibu as well. Chevrolet says the Malibu Hybrid is expected to yield a combined fuel consumption of an impressive 5.2L/100km. Powering the Malibu Hybrid will be an all-new direct-injection 1.8L 4-cylinder, mated to a two-motor drive unit, not dissimilar to the 2016 Chevrolet Volt drive unit. The drive unit will provide additional power to assist the engine during acceleration. This engine and dual-motor drive unit combination will be good for 182 horsepower of total system power. The new engine also features Chevrolet’s first application of Exhaust Gas Heat Recovery, or EGHR, technology. This tech takes the heat the exhaust generates and sends it on into the cabin and engine. The new 80-cell, 1.5 kWh lithium-ion battery pack takes care of electric power in the system and can propel the Malibu to 90 km/h on electricity alone. At higher speeds and loads, the Malibu automatically switches over to the gas engine, as expected. Pricing is yet to be announced.

Nissan Announces $35,900 CAD Starting M.S.R.P. for All-New Maxima

Nissan has announced Canadian pricing for the all-new 2016 Nissan Maxima, which made its world debut at the recent

New York International Auto Show. The eighth-generation of Nissan’s iconic “4-Door Sports Car” is scheduled to arrive at Nissan dealers nation-wide beginning this summer.The all-new Maxima, a virtual clone of the stunning Nissan Sport Sedan Concept, is low-er, longer and lighter than the previous generation de-sign. Helping Maxima push the performance envelope in its segment is a complete-ly revised 300-horsepower 3.5-litre VQ-series V6 engine and new performance-oriented Xtronic transmission. The compre-hensive re-engineering effort also re-sulted in a 15 per cent increase in highway fuel economy. The new Maxima also features a premium bespoke crafted interior, anchored by a command central driver’s cockpit, that rivals luxury vehicles.Manufacturer’s Suggested Retail Prices* (MSRP) for the 2016 Nissan Maxima: Maxima

SV $35,900 CAD, Maxima SL $38,950 CAD, Maxima SR $41,100 CAD, Maxima Platinum $43,300

CAD Maxima’s next-generation technology

features include standard NissanCon-nect with navigation and avail-

able 11-speaker Bose® premium audio system, NissanCon-nect Services powered by SiriusXM, and Around View® Monitor (AVM) with Moving Object Detection (MOD). The 2016 Maxima also offers an extensive range of safety, security and driving aids, in-cluding Predictive Forward Collision Warning (PFCW),

Intelligent Cruise Control (ICC), Forward Emergency Braking (FEB),

Rear Cross Traffic Alert (CTA) and Blind Spot Warning (BSW). These features are

available on Maxima SL, SR and Platinum grades. Maxima Platinum includes an available

Driver Attention Alert (DAA) system, which moni-tors each individual driver’s steering patterns** and helps alert the driver when signs of drowsy or inattentive driving is detected.

Canadians love the efficiency and nimble performance of subcompacts – and this year we’ll give drivers even more of what they love, with an all-new Yaris Sedan,” said Larry Hutchinson, Vice President at Toyota Canada Inc. “Coming

later this year, the Yaris Sedan embodies bold, aggressive styling and premium fea-tures.”

The new 2016 Toyota Yaris Sedan is more than just a new car with a familiar name. Responding to the needs and desires of Canadian drivers, this new premium sub-compact brings upscale features, dynamic handling, and fresh styling to an efficient vehicle that’s popular in a market segment that Canadians love. Take one look, and the Yaris Sedan impresses with a striking profile that stands out from the crowd. Up front, the bold new face of Yaris features sharp-eyed headlights and a hexagon lower grille, while a spacious trunk gives the rear a distinctive look.

Premium details abound – from the piano black bumpers, to the chrome grille sur-round and tailpipe, to the power-adjustable heated exterior mirrors, to the keyless entry offered as standard on all models.

Open the door and slip behind the sporty steering wheel, and admire the surprising-

ly roomy cabin filled with premium amenities. Steering wheel mounted switches put audio and Bluetooth con-trols within easy reach, while the available Display Audio System features a seven-inch touch screen, six speakers, two USB audio inputs, and an Auxiliary audio jack. Avail-able amenities include an upgraded multimedia system with voice recognition controls and a back-up camera.

The Yaris Sedan is standard equipped with an impressive list of features – including cruise control, power windows and power door locks – all set off with chrome accents and the soft-touch trim and surfaces one expects from a premium sport sedan.

The trunk is spacious, and made even more versatile thanks to a standard 60/40 split folding rear seat. If the style promises fun, the performance delivers. Hit the Push Button Start and Yaris Sedan’s high-spirited, 106 horsepower, 1.5L four-cylinder engine comes to life with a sporty yet muted rasp.

The Yaris Sedan is offered with a choice of compact and lightweight six-speed manual or six-speed automatic transmissions: The manual transmission features a short stroke for quick shifting while the available automatic transmission with lock-up torque converter delivers a direct-shift feel and impressive efficiency, plus a Sport Mode feature that boosts torque for more spirited driving.

To squeeze the most out of this drive train, Toyota designed agility into the Yaris Se-dan with a highly-rigid body structure enhanced with front and rear suspensions that strike a balance between sporty handling and ride comfort. Toyota engineers then added steering and braking systems carefully tuned to deliver the handling worthy of a sport sedan.

And because the Yaris Sedan is a Toyota, it’s also the subcompact that’s big on safety, featuring active and passive systems that work together to keep driver and occu-pants safe.

The 2016 Toyota Yaris Sedan arrives at Toyota Dealers across Canada later this year. More details, including additional specifications and pricing, will be available closer to the on-sale date.

When Scion launched in Canada, the brand set out to reach younger and new to Toyota customers. Five years later, with an average customer age of 37.5 years and 69 per cent of Scion buyers new to the Toyota Canada

family, Scion achieved just that. This year, Scion is taking its next step in the brand’s evolution, with a new phase of dealer expansions. The current total of 94 Scion dealerships in Canada will rise to 145 as of July. This means almost 60 per cent of Toyota dealerships in Canada will soon have dedicated Scion displays – allowing the brand to reach new customers in markets where the brand is not yet available. “This is a great time for Scion in Canada, and we’re anticipating a new wave of mo-mentum for the brand,” said Cyril Dimitris, Director, and Scion Canada. “Scion is strengthening its commitment to Canada by seeking to engage and connect with customers in different ways, and bringing Scion closer to the homes of many Canadians is just the next step.”With a mission to bring younger buyers into the Toyo-ta Canada family, Scion has launched five unique models, including the tC and FR-S, as well as the brand new Scion iM which will arrive later in 2015.The iM is a sleek, fun and versatile five-door hatch-back that is perfect for Canadians who value fuel

efficiency, sporty handling and loads of cargo room. The “i” stands for individuality and intriguing, and the “M” represents modern, multifaceted and magnetic. The Sci-on iM will inspire its owners with a sense of spontaneity while maintaining the peace of mind provided by Toyota’s renowned quality, dependability, reliability and safety.Not just with the new iM, but across all its vehicles, Scion has a foundation built on passion. Last year, Scion invited its owners to pursue their passions by launching a major brand campaign called “Powering Passion”. Scion reached out to owners in Canada to learn more about the activities they’re passionate about, and the impor-tant role their Scion vehicles played in their lives. The stories of six individuals were selected to be showcased – each with a unique story to tell.In addition, Scion has developed various grassroots programs in the Canadian

motorsport and music sector. This includes Scion’s involvement as the title sponsor

of Formula Drift Canada, as well as partnerships with Canadian drift

drivers. Scion is also active on the music and Canadian cul-

tural scene, supporting emerging music artists through “Scion Sessions”

and other events, such as Villa Para-dizo music festival in Montreal.

Subaru Unveils STI Performance Concept -By Veeno DewanSubaru Canada, Inc. (SCI) announced the unveiling of the STI Performance

Concept at the recent New York International Auto Show. The STI Performance Concept signifies the North American expansion of Subaru Tecnica International,

Inc. (STI) – the performance division of Subaru – in its three core business areas: parts and accessories, complete cars and motorsports. Looking ahead, parts and accessories as well as further models tuned by STI will be available in Canada, focusing on suspension, braking, chassis and aerodynamic upgrades. There is also potential for an increased engineering presence in future motorsports activity. Complete cars and performance parts available now in Japan focus on the WRX STI, Forester and BRZ models. The Japanese domestic market uses the nomenclature “S model” as its naming for the WRX STI and uses “tS” on BRZ and Forester vehicles that have STI components, but a naming convention for any future North American models has not yet been established. The STI Performance Concept is a showcase for the engineering prowess and tuning capabilities of STI, featuring the racing engine developed by STI for the BRZ Super GT racecar, suspension and chassis components and aerodynamic upgrades. The STI Performance Concept was developed for display purposes to announce the launch of the North American expansion of the STI brand and performance division of Subaru. There are no plans for Subaru to build or produce any production model resembling the STI Performance Concept, including a turbocharged BRZ. This is

strictly a concept vehicle with a specially designed race engine prepared for track-use only. “At STI we know from our racing that to win, it is important not only to have high power, but also that all aspects of performance are balanced over the whole car,” said Yoshio Hirakawa, president of Subaru Tecnica International, Inc. “When we achieve this balance, the driver feels that the car is easy to handle and reliable, and he can use it fully to the limits of its performance. Our plan is to produce cars and accessories that drivers can really enjoy, not only through power alone, but also to deliver balanced performance over the whole car.” “Subaru has an unwavering commitment to safety, performance, versatility and durability,” said Shiro Ohta, chairman, president and CEO of Subaru Canada, Inc. “The North American expansion of STI, the performance division of Subaru, speaks to these underlying characteristics of the Subaru brand and further enhances our commitment to performance.” STI was founded as Subaru parent company Fuji Heavy Industries’ motor sports division in 1988. In 1989, a first-generation Subaru Legacy, tuned by STI, broke the FIA-certified world speed record over 100,000 kilometers. From there, STI moved on to the World Rally Championship, winning 3 constructors championships and 3 driver championships for Colin McRae, Richard Burns and Petter Solberg. It currently competes in the Nurburgring 24 Hour Challenge race winning its class two times in 2011 and 2012 and also in the Super GT series with its BRZ-based Super GT.

The Kia Motors design team has swept the board yet again in the an-nual Red Dot Awards, picking up two ‘Red Dots’ for the outstanding product design of the Kia Soul EV and all-new Kia Sorento SUV. The

Red Dot Awards program is one of the most highly-respected internation-al design competitions in the world, and celebrates its 60th anniversary in 2015. This year, the jury – made up of design experts from a range of in-dustries – awarded a ‘Winner’ and ‘Honourable Mention’ distinction to the Kia Soul EV and Kia Sorento, respectively, in recognition of their exceptional design details.Ever since receiving its first award at this internationally recognized design competition in 2009, Kia’s design-oriented products have been successful every single year. In total, 13 Kia models have now won a Red Dot Award, in addition to many other design prizes.These aren’t the first awards for the recently-launched Kia Soul and flagship new-generation Sorento, both of which have been awarded coveted iF De-sign Awards in 2014 and 2015 respectively. The Kia Soul – the sister model to the EV electric version – also received a Red Dot Award in 2014. The ‘Red Dot Award: Prod- uct Design’ is the world’s biggest and most international product design competi-tion. This year, 1,994 companies from 56 countries entered 4,925 new products for one of the highly coveted Red Dots.

-By Veeno Dewan2016 Toyota RAV4 Hybrid Debut Seventh Hybrid in Toyota LineupThere’s a new hybrid in town, and it’s called RAV4. Toyota Canada has been

the overwhelming gas-electric hybrid sales leader since 2004. Now, 15 years after the first Prius was sold in Canada, Toyota has unveiled its seventh hybrid

offered as part of the refreshed 2016 RAV4. Launching this fall, the RAV4 Hybrid will be targeted towards young adventure-seeking couples looking for a vehicle that provides utility, versatility, capability and excellent fuel efficiency. Fewer fill-ups will become the norm with the addition of a new, fuel efficient RAV4 Hybrid. Better fuel economy comes without sacrifice, as the RAV4 Hybrid will deliver more horsepower and better acceleration than the con-ventional RAV4. A no compromise vehicle, the RAV4 Hybrid will be offered in two premium grades; XLE and Limited. Both grades will be equipped with an Electronic On-Demand All-Wheel-Drive System with intelligence (AWD-i). Also available will be unique 17-inch and 18-inch alloy wheels and ten exterior colours (including a new blue). The conventional gas version RAV4 will come in four grades: LE, XLE, Limited and the new SE. Together with the new Hybrid XLE and Limited, all 2016 RAV4 models will feature refreshed exterior styling, providing a sleeker, more dynamic appearance. It starts with a new, stronger look-ing front fascia with an available LED trifecta (Headlights, Daytime Running Lights and Hi-Lo Headlights). The new styling extends along the lower rocker panel to the rear bumper for a flowing visual appeal. A new rear bumper and lift gate with avail-able LED taillights add a premium touch. Additional new exterior features include front and rear silver skid plate garnishes on most models and a standard shark fin antenna. An all-new wheel lineup, and three new exterior paint colours (Silver Sky

Metallic, Black Currant Metallic, and Electric Storm Blue) round out the exterior de-sign.Toyota listened to customer feedback and added more refinement and technology to the interior. Additional convenience technologies include available front and rear parking sonar, available Smart Key, and integrated garage door opener (stan-dard on Limited grade). All RAV4 SE and Limited models will come standard with SiriusXM All-Access Radio with a 3-month complimentary trial. RAV4 will also offer a new available Bird’s Eye View Monitor. This Toyota-first tech-

nology utilizes four cameras that are mounted on the front, side mirrors and rear of the vehicle to

give the driver a panoramic view of their sur-roundings. The system offers drivers assis-

tance when parallel parking, and when pulling in and out of parking spaces. The

Bird’s Eye View Monitor system also has an industry-first feature called Perimeter Scan,

that gives drivers a live rotating 360-degree view of what is around the vehicle, helping them

see objects that could be in the way. The new SE grade features a sport-tuned suspension,

providing a more dynamic and responsive driving experi-ence. The SE also adds premium convenience features and

performance styling cues, inside and out. The RAV4 started the small SUV segment craze 20 years ago. Five years later, Toyota introduced hybrids to the North American market, raising the bar for excellent fuel economy at an affordable price. Each has helped change the automotive land-scape. The arrival of the 2016 RAV4 Hybrid will be a natural fit for young buyers seeking the winning combination of affordable SUV utility and the fuel efficiency of Toyota’s Hybrid Synergy Drive.

1. Nissan Micra ($9,998) The Nissan Micra is one of the better sub compacts on the market. The base five door- hatchback model arrives with a manual transmission and wind up windows, but does have a sprightly 1.6L DOHC four-cylinder engine with 109 hp and 107 pound-feet of torque. It is a fun car to drive with a quick shifting five-speed manual transmission and is fun to drive. Fuel economy is good at 8.8 litres per 100 km in the city and 6.6 L/100 km on the highway.

2. Mitsubishi Mirage ($9,998 -$12,995)The 2015 Mitsubishi Mirage is one of the most fuel-efficient non -hybrid cars in Canada, Thanks to a tiny 74 horsepower, 1.2L three -cylinder engine and a five-speed transmission- Fuel efficiency is rated at an impressive 5.3 L/100 km on the highway or 6.4 L/100 km in the city. The Mirage is pretty basis with its equipment spec, and it would be worth stepping up to the higher grade model to get some extra features. It is plain and simple and comes in some bright fun colors. Cheap and cheerful, the tiny Mitsubishi does come with an amaz-ing 10 year warrantee- so worth considering.

3. Fiat 500 POP ($13,495) The stylish European designed Fiat 500 POP is miniscule, and comes as three- door version, cool cabrio (At a premium price) or as the much bigger and more expensive 500L five-door model. The three-door POP comes equipped with a 1.4L engine with a five-speed manual transmission. Very stylish inside and out with delightful European touches, the three door however, does suffer from a cramped backseat and not much legroom in the rear. Despite this, it is a fun to drive car with very good fuel economy at 5.8 litres per 100 km.

4. Hyundai Accent ($13,549)The Accent is a sleek, good-looking car with Hyundai’s signature flowing design. Equip-ment levels are high, and it arrives in either a sedan and hatch version. It is fairly fuel effi-cient to boot with the L version’s 1.6-liter engine mated to a six speed manual transmission. Fuel economy is rated at City 8.7L/100km, Highway 6.3L/100km, Combined 7.6L/100km6L from the GDI DOHC Engine. A very comfortable and well equipped car with an iPod/CD au-dio system as standard, power windows, SiriusXM satellite radio, steering wheel-mounted audio controls, ABS, heated sideview mirrors, rear window defroster. Highly rated and a good all-around buy.

Sub Compact Car Shootout! The Top 12 Most Affordable Cars in Canada

5. Chevrolet Spark ($13,745)The Chevrolet Spark looks tiny, yet seats four adults comfortably. Its stylish looks are at-tractive and it can be optioned with some cool technology features. The Spark is powered by an EcoTec 1.2L four-cylinder engine paired to a five-speed manual tranny. While there is an AM/FM radio equipped with an auxiliary input jack, there is no CD player. The car also comes with a powertrain warranty of five-years/160,000 km. It is a fun, cheerful car and a great first vehicle for a young person.

6. Nissan Versa Note ($14, 298)The 2014 Nissan Versa 1.6 Hatchback is bigger than the Nissan Micra and more stylish with a surprisingly roomy interior. The base model arrives with the same engine as the Micra - a 1.6-litre, DOHC, four-cylinder engine producing 109 horsepower and 107 lb.-ft. of torque hooked to a five-speed manual transmission. There is a little more refinement to the Versa, and it looks and feels weighty and substantial. Highly recommended.

7. Ford Fiesta ($14,394)The Ford Fiesta S starts at $14,394 for both the hatchback and sedan versions, and is an-other recommended buy. Safety is very high with seven airbags as standard and Ford’s Ad-vanceTrac Electronic Stability Control system. Power is via a 1.6-litre four-cylinder engine mated to a five-speed auto transmission. An AM/FM/CD player with audio input jack and a high quality interior are standouts.

8. Mazda2 ($14,450) The smart looking Mazda2 hatchback looks really small, thanks to tiny front and rear overhangs, but seats four adults in comfort. The Mazda2 arrives with a fuel-efficient 1.5L four-cylinder engine, rated at 100 horsepower and 98 lb.-ft. of torque. A 5-Speed manual is standard. Power windows and locks are standard in the Mazda2. Fun to drive with good handling, it is well finished and robust.

9. Honda Fit DX ($14,495)One of the class leaders, and more at the top end of the sub compact in terms of price, equipment and quality. Superbly versatile, roomy and well equipped ─ The $15,000 Fit base DX comes with a 130-hp, 1.5-litre four-cylinder engine, power windows, traction con-trol, anti-lock brakes, an AM/FM/CD system with an auxiliary input jack, and also comes standard with a colour touchscreen and Bluetooth. Honda’s magic seat feature allow for excellent passenger and cargo carrying flexibility. Highly recommended.

10. Toyota Yaris hatchback CE ($14,595)The cute, three-door Yaris hatchback is well proven and comes extremely highly equipped when it comes to safety. There are nine airbags, including front seat cushion airbags, which make it a top pick in my opinion. It is also well equipped with power, steering, power locks and a class leading as standard colour touchscreen. A 1.6-liter engine hooked to a five speed manual gearbox delivers a fuel efficiency rating of 5.2 L/100 km (highway).

11. Kia Rio ($15,630)The Kia Rio LX is one of the best-equipped sub-compact cars you can buy and is a bargain for the price. There is a fuel-efficient 1.6L, four-cylinder engine with a six speed manual transmission as standard. The equipment list also features: a radio/CD stereo system, aux. and USB input ports, dual front power outlets, electronic stability control, Smart, contem-porary looking and roomy the Rio is a good family hauler.

12) Chevrolet Sonic ($15,895)The Chevrolet Sonic and Spark hatchback look similar, but the Sonic is better looking more substantial and powerful. In addition the Sonic comes as a 5-door hatchback or a 4-door sedan while the Spark, is only offered as a 5-door hatchback. The Sonic is different un-der the hood as well and offers two engines that both produce 138 horsepower: a 1.8-liter 4-cylinder producing 125 lb-ft of torque, and a 1.4-liter turbocharged 4-cylinder that offers better fuel economy and 148 lb-ft of torque. With more features, a better interior and more power the Sonic is a good all-round sub compact car for all the family.

- Auto Trends Special Supplement -By Veeno Dewan

Need a second car or a new car for a younger member of the family? Buying second hand does make sense, but the lower your budget, the less of a reliable bargain of a car you will find is usually how it works. No doubt…a new car is an expensive proposition. However aim your sights a little lower from a brand new BMW or a Mercedes and you will be surprised at what is available brand new for under $16,000 in the sub-compact cars. As a guide; sub compact cars

are sized under the compact class, and come with small, economical four- cylinder engines. They can range from basic Spartan specifications to downright luxuri-ous as you add options or opt for higher range models. Buyer should beware however, low sticker prices look attractive, but are for all, but the basic models and mostly do not include destination freight, Pre- delivery Inspection or Dealer prep prices that generally add from $1000 to $2000 plus to the MRSP. Other cost tacked on also can annoy and surprise you. However do your research; choose models wisely, ensure you know the dealer invoice price (What the dealer paid) and you can still get a good deal. Remember options like: automatic transmissions, electric windows, Power features, navigation systems, and other goodies can jack the price up considerably. Here is our guide to the most affordable sub-compact cars in Canada. Happy hunting.

Kanata, Ontario - During last week’s live, season-finale broadcast of Rogers Hometown Hockey, The Sullivan fam-ily of Orangeville, Ontario was named Canada’s Ultimate

Hockey Family, receiving the keys to a brand-new 2015 Dodge Grand Caravan, valued at over $33,000.“There [are] so many exciting and incredible aspects about winning the Dodge Grand Caravan,” said David Sullivan, who received the keys to his new Canadian-built minivan from Rog-ers Hometown Hockey’s on-air reporter, Tara Slone, during Sun-day’s broadcast. “The fact that my wife and I just had our first daughter three months ago the timing could not be any more perfect. I know that time is going to fly by and in a flash it will be her equipment that I am throwing in the trunk before head-ing off to the rink. “ , Canadian families were asked to submit a photo and caption, explaining why they are our nation’s Ultimate Hockey Family. The Orangeville family was selected from over 1,500 entries voted on by FCA Canada and Rogers Communications representatives.The Sullivans submitted an on-ice photo of 50-plus family mem-bers and explained that it was the 30th annual family skate: “De-nis Sullivan played hockey until the age of 60,” read their caption. “13 of his children and dozens of his grandchildren have contin-ued to play in organized hockey over the years. Every Christmas we gather to celebrate the holidays, family, and Canada’s great-est game!”Founded in 2006, the Dodge Caravan Kids program is a joint ef-fort between participating minor hockey associations through-out the country in partnership with FCA Canada and Chrysler, Jeep®, Dodge, Ram, FIAT retailers. The program provides up to $500 in funding and access to exclusive hockey benefits for novice-level hockey teams across Canada. Since the program started, the Dodge brand has provided over $6 million in pro-gram funding to help over 12,000 teams and over 180,000 kids play the game of hockey.

- By Veeno Dewan2015 Chevrolet Impala Sedan Sleek domestic sedan has the right stuff!

For 2015 the all-new, tenth generation 2014 Chevrolet Impala returns with a fresh contemporary

design and some newly minted mojo. For openers a dramatic, long lean body exterior is now offered with some real all-American flair. The recessed side character line adds some tension and speed to the profile and a radical c-pillar puts some flourish along with some nice chrome trim on the exterior. The Impala arrives with a base 2.4L 4-cylinder engine producing 182 hp and 172 lb-ft of torque or a bigger; more powerful 3.6L V6 with 305 horsepower and 264 lb-ft of torque mated to a 6-speed automatic gearbox. Also new is an attractive, contemporary interior with a cool dual cockpit theme and the use of higher quality materials. The centre stack is attractively done and easy on the eye. There is a richer look and more substantial padding on the doors, armrest and dash. The cabin feels more generous and well- upholstered. The front seats are

superbly comfortable and

feature plenty of legroom. Likewise front headroom and shoulder

room as in most domestic cars, is more than ample The dash is also bright and well laid out with clear, legible instruments and the addition of an 8” touchscreen relaying and operating the Impalas climate, navigation and entertainment systems. There is also a smaller information screen between the gauges that is handy for relaying info at a quick glance. Push a button and the centre display rises to reveal a lockable secret storage cubby for valuables. The 2015 Chevrolet offers a slew of technology, including the newest generation MyLink infotainment system. Voice activation is used for navigation programming, dialing phone numbers and for the audio songs.

We have all been there at some point and expe-rienced that horrible gnawing feeling as your vital to work, life and home vehicle breaks

down and need repairs. You can’t help but think a lot of the time, that you’re going to get fleeced into over-paying by the garage. However there are a few simple tips to avoid this:1) Prevention is better than Cure. If you don’t ever check the health of your vehicle and ignore any poten-tial problems you can expect to spend a lot of money fixing problems that could have been prevented later. The golden rule perhaps for saving money is “don’t put it off or ignore it”. this means not ignoring things like strange noises, vibrations, and weird things that happen when you start and drive your vehicle. For example; if your brakes are making noises, get them checked. It may mean they need new brake pads or some sort of adjustment. If you put it off, your brake pads could grind down on the brake rotors. Its not only unsafe, you end up having to replace the rotors and calipers instead of just the pads, which is an easy fix. Hit a pothole or curb in your car and find you steer-ing is out of whack and now pulls to the side a bit? – ignore it and it’s not only dangerous it means uneven tire wear and quicker replacement. Same with things like oil, water and other fluid leaks. They leak for a rea-son! Something is busted, weak or about to break. Ig-nore any leak around the engine and d transmission no matter how small and before you know it, you’re spending thousands on a rebuild or a new engine or transmission.2) Don’t ignore the Check Engine Light. Ahh!!! The dreaded check engine light! It’s easy to ignore if your vehicle still trundles along. It could be something in-

nocuous, but you should ignore this warn-ing at your peril. With all aspects of a car computerized nowadays, the check engine light could mean anything. Unless you can run your own diagnostics with some com-puter apps and cables you can buy, its best to get a mechanic to check and get the problem fixed right away. If you are lucky

it could be a common problem such as a loose wire, an intermittent connection or a bad sensor that is rela-tively cheap and easy to fix. Ignore the check engine light for long enough and something minor can easily escalate into something major. Something that would of cost a few dollars or a few hundred to fix could easily end up costing thousands 3) Check Car Forum websites. This may seem odd, but do an internet search for your cars make, model, year and you can probably find out immediately what the most common problems are with you vehicle and what to expect. Forums are also great for getting feedback from owners who have handled these problems and from mechanics who have actually fixed or come across these problems and are willing to tell you how much a good shop should charge. You may find your cars problem may actually be a recall issue and should be covered under a recall notice and fixed free by the manufacturer. If not, you may at least find the problem to be a common issue and learn how it that it can be fixed or the cheapest solution to get it repaired. At the very least, researching will yield

valuable nuggets of information on your vehicle. 4) Get a second opinion. If it is unavoidable and you have to get the vehicles problem fixed at a mechanic, even if you’ve found a reputable garage or mechanic, that doesn’t mean you can’t still ask around and get a second opinion. Especially true if you think you’re be-ing conned into repairs that don’t need doing or if you feel instinctively that things feel right in your interac-tion with mechanic.5) Get written estimates for repairs. Good for compari-son and shopping around for quotes. Make sure you don’t share the first garage’s diagnosis and estimate with the second one. See what the second garage says the problem is, and how much they’re willing to charge you for it. Then compare both estimates and quotes - The difference can be staggering as to how much money you can save.

The very capable Mitsubishi RVR is a mid-size SUV that has done rather well in Canada with good sales since its 2010 in- troduction. For

2015 the RVR has a few minor changes. Of significance is the revised and upgraded continuously variable transmission (CVT) that offers better fuel economy, and new LED headlights for the up-scale GT model. The RVR underwent some major revision in 2014 and continues as a handsome, good looking, and very capable SUV. There are five trim levels: ES 2WD, SE 2WD, SE AWC, SE AWC Limited Edition, and GT AWC. Front-wheel-drive models come standard with a five-speed manual, but can be had with the CVT for an extra $1,300 – it’s standard on AWC (All-Wheel Control) vehicles. All vehicles come with the standard 2.0-litre engine, which pro-duces 148 horsepower and 145 pound-feet of torque. Prices range from $19,998 for the ES FWD model to $28,898 for the GT AWC. The Mitsubishi RVR relies on a highly ef-ficient four-cylinder engine with either a 5-speed manual transmission or with a Sportronic 6-speed CVT with magnesium-alloy paddle shifters. Coupled with a com-pact, lightweight body, the Mitsubishi RVR was designed from the beginning to deliver “smart” performance. An energy-recycling regenerative braking system, eco-friendly technology such as parasitic drag-reducing electric steering (EPS) and wind tunnel-tested aerodynamics give the Mitsubishi RVR excellent fuel economy ratings. Showcasing a premium, value-minded list of features, the RVR is packed with cut-ting edge entertainment, driver’s aid technologies and advanced safety features. Features such as Active Stability Control (ASC), Hill Start Assist (HSA), and Anti-lock Brakes (ABS) are just a few of RVRs premium features. Order a GT model and the equipment list includes automatic climate control, heated seats, all the usual power assists, tilt-telescope wheel with audio and cruise controls, fast key entry, a panoramic sunroof and roof rails. A $3,500 package adds naviga-tion, leather, a power driver’s seat and a rear-view camera. Cabin-wise the RVR has a spacious front cabin and enough room in all quarters. However the rear cabin would

be a tight squeeze for three adults. Cargo capacity is 614 litres with the rear seatback upright and 1,402 with

the seat down. The RVR is powered by a 2.0-litre, double-overhead-cam engine rated at 148 hp and 145 lb-ft of torque and power is transmitted to all four wheels in the AWD models by Mitsubishi’s world-class, rally developed All Wheel Control system. The Sportronic CVT can be semi manually shifted via the magnesium paddle shifters that

allow for six default six ratios. On the road, the RVR is quiet at highway speeds, although the CVT drone is still present but not so irritating as some units on other rivals vehicles. 148 Horsepower may not sound like a lot, but the RVR dis-plays acceptable acceleration. Steering is well modulated and nicely weighted and it’s obvious that the tweaked suspension allows for a more comfortable ride.What seem like firmer spring rates allow for more cargo-hauling capabilities.In the wet and slippery surfaces, the RVR feels sure-footed and handles various road surfaces. The RVR’s fuel economy rating is 8.5 li-tres/100 km city in the city and 6.6 li-tres/100 km highway. To sum up the RVR is a smart-sized, cross-over that combines excellent fuel-efficiency with premium

features and greater functionality. Like any Mitsubishi, one of the RVR’s biggest sell-ing points is its standard warranty – 5 years/100,000 km comprehensive coverage and 10 years/160,000 km powertrain. Highly recommended. 2015 Mitsubishi RVR Base Price: $19,998 to $28,998 plus options

Safety is also well catered for with a range of systems: An optional adaptive cruise control uses radar technology to calculate traffic ahead then adjusts the Impala’s speed accordingly or brings the vehicle to a safe full stop, if necessary. Collision Mitigation Braking is also present, and uses an audio warning and, if necessary, applies the brakes to avoid a collision.

The Impala is also admirably quite on the road with such measures as laminated glass and acoustic foam between body panels to insulate road noise and vibration. The 2.4 liter four cylinder engine is good for its performance and the 182 horsepower is perfectly adequate, however the bigger V6 engine turns the Impala into a much faster accelerating and more powerful sedan and gives it some more spark should you need it. This engine is rated at 11.1L/100km city and 6.9L highway.For the money the Impala comes incredibly well equipped with luxury and option packs that won’t break the bank and would cost you tens of thousands of dollars more in higher prices imports. Highly recommended if a big comfortable easy to drive sedan on your list. Auto review by Veeno Dewan.2015 Chevrolet Impala LTZ Sedan base price $39,845. Price as tested with options and destination charge $46,300.
